Tisdale
Tisdale is a toponym and surname. The most prominent use is Tisdale, a town in east-central Saskatchewan, Canada. It serves as a local service center for the surrounding agricultural region and forms part of the province’s network of small towns that support farming communities. The name is of English origin and has been used for several other places across North America, including small unincorporated communities in the United States.
